GOVERNANCE BOARD MEETING

Amana Academy's Governance Board will hold it's monthly public meeting on Saturday, August 23 from 9:00 AM until 11:00 AM in the Parent Center, located in suite 109A (between the school's main building and Satay House).

 
All meetings of the Amana Board are posted to our website calendar and open to the public unless designated as "executive session" where, by law, the Board must convene in private to discuss land, legal or personnel items. Any vote resulting from executive session discussion, however, will occur in an open public setting.

UNIFORM UPDATE
It's hot outside now, but the colder weather is on the way and we're ready with a new addition to the dress code uniform! Introducing the zipper front sweater in navy from French Toast. The sweater may be ordered beginning next week and must have the Amana logo. 

Amana's Uniform Dress Code will be fully enforced on the Elementary Campus beginning Monday, August 25th. Students who are not in appropriate dress code will be sent to the office to call their parent to bring them appropriate clothing. Reminder: All boys in grades K-8 must have their shirts tucked in and wear a black or brown belt. 

Many of you have asked for clarification on the uniform policy around shoes. It was intended that students would wear a solid black or brown shoe on non-PE days, and that they wear a solid colored athletic shoe for PE on the days they had it. Since this was not made completely clear in the 2014-15 uniform policy, students will be allowed to wear any solid colored athletic shoe (including soles and decoration).   If you have purchased a solid black or brown athletic shoe, that shoe will suffice for both the uniform requirement and for PE.

Please note that we are moving toward making solid dark-colored shoes (black or brown) mandatory, except for PE (students may change out of uniform shoes for PE, but should put their uniform shoes back on after PE). This change will go into effect next school year. If you have already purchased shoes in a color other than black or brown for your student to wear, please send a note in to your child's teacher next week. Please direct any questions regarding the uniform policy to Ms. McClure for Elementary students and Ms. Campbell for Middle School students.

At Amana, our motto is We are Crew, Not Passengers. This applies to students, faculty, staff AND parents.  We are all part of the same crew, and that means we need everyone on board and involved from the very start.  To make this process easier for the parent members of our crew, we are offering some orientation sessions that coincide with curriculum nights this year.  

Parents who volunteer in the classroom, or who want to serve as a chaperon on a field study, need to complete an Amana orientation session in addition to filling out the Volunteer Information Form and completing the state-required Mandated Reporter Training.  If you attend one of the three orientation sessions being offered immediately before curriculum nights, you can complete all three of these requirements at once.  We encourage as many parents as possible to take advantage of this opportunity.  The schedule is a follows:
